Hilfer-Katugampola fractional derivative

Published 15 May 2017 in math.CA, math-ph, and math.MP | (1705.07733v2)

Abstract: We propose a new fractional derivative, the Hilfer-Katugampola fractional derivative. Motivated by the Hilfer derivative this formulation interpolates the well-known fractional derivatives of Hilfer, Hilfer-Hadamard, Riemann-Liouville, Hadamard, Caputo, Caputo-Hadamard, Liouville, Weyl, generalized and Caputo-type. As an application, we consider a nonlinear fractional differential equation with an initial condition using this new formulation. We show that this equation is equivalent to a Volterra integral equation and demonstrate the existence and uniqueness of solution to the nonlinear initial value problem.
